So, it will be really good for research purposes or if you just want to test your idea. Read this blog to learn about the shift-left approach in software testing and how to… Skill-based hiring allows you to access a larger pool of developers and reduces hiring time,… Join a network of the world’s best developers and get long-term remote software jobs with better compensation and career growth.
In addition, Python is one of the reasons AI has become so popular in recent years. The most used libraries for AI such as Scikit-Learn, Keras, TensorFlow, and PyTorch were written in Python. Originally published on Towards AI the World’s Leading AI and Technology News and Media Company. If you are building an AI-related product or service, we invite you to consider becoming an AI sponsor. Due to its conciseness, object purity, simplicity and better OOP implementation, Smalltalk has started regaining the attention it always deserved as an AI language.
The principle of operation is that the machine receives data and learns from them. It does not just simulate the behavior of people but imitates their learning. ML has come a long way in the development, and it resulted in the fact that it was used in most software products in 2020.
The language overrides the complexities of 3D games, optimizing resource management and facilitating multiplayer with networking. A real-world example is the science fiction game Doom 3, which uses C++ and the Unreal Engine, a suite of game development tools (written in C++). Microsoft Windows, Mac OS, Adobe Photoshop, Maya 3D software, CAD, and Mozilla Firefox are a few famous applications of C++. Its most common features are efficient pattern matching, tree-based data structuring, and automatic backtracking. Prolog was specifically designed for natural language processing, which is why this technology is mostly used for developing chatbots.
Consider how complicated this may be based on the talent pool in your area, and if regional considerations will be a factor. Choosing the right language for your AI project is an art as much as it is a science. You’ll need to consider the parameters of your project to determine the best fit.
The term “artificial intelligence” was first coined in 1956 by computer scientist John McCarthy, when the field of artificial intelligence research was founded as an academic discipline. It’s essentially the process of making a computer system that can learn and work on its own. If you’re just learning to program for AI now, there are many advantages to beginning with Python. You can hit the ground running and start developing immediately. Technically, you can use any language for AI programming — some just make it easier than others. Let’s take a look at some of the other best languages for AI.
AI developers value it for its pre-designed search mechanism, non-determinism, backtracking mechanism, recursive nature, high-level abstraction, and pattern matching. A high-level, event-driven, interpreted programming language that is mostly used to make webpages interactive and create online programs and games. ValueCoders has been able to establish the continuity of the development process. On balance, we can say that it was the right decision to outsource the development to India and that ValueCoders was the right choice. I engaged with ValueCoders in January of this year to provide software development expertise for our 20/20 B.E.S.T Safety Software and the results have been fantastic! So, it depends upon the app type as well as what AI programming language to use.
You really don’t need to choose one single programming language for your product. You can combine different languages using modern architectural approaches, such as Microservices. Because of its capacity to execute challenging mathematical operations and lengthy natural language processing functions, Wolfram is popular as a computer algebraic language. R is a popular language for AI among both aspiring and experienced statisticians. Though R isn’t the best programming language for AI, it is great for complex calculations. Lisp is one of the most widely used programming languages for AI.
LISP is undoubtedly a niche language, though it has devoted fans who are willing to work around its shortcomings. However, even if you don’t plan to use LISP for developing AI applications, learning it can help you understand how AI has evolved and can make you a better AI developer. It’s used by numerous tech giants, including Google, Microsoft, and Facebook. It has its own quint model for working with data, that allows creating databases fast. The cost of hiring a software development team is at an all-time high.
🔱Sanskrit, an ancient Hindu language, is thought by NASA to be the best language for Artificial Intelligence.
AI there is no life which brings immense technological revolution in this era through one language
I believe it will have an enormous impact on human interpretations🕉️
— Sri Krishna Deva Raya (@ChiluveruShashi) February 24, 2023
There’s no one language that’s best for AI, but one may be better than another for your specific project. In this article, we’ll go over the languages that are best for AI development and some that you might want to avoid. By harnessing the power of AI, your business can accelerate growth, saving time and money by optimizing your processes and operations. AI can handle some tasks faster and more accurately than humans. You can incorporate AI into tools that will boost your employee’s abilities to make on-the-spot decisions based on customer input or data. Talk with one of our experts today to learn how we can help you scale your development efforts or create a custom application.
A good AI programming language should be easy to learn, read, and deploy. Many web-developing firms use Smalltalk on a very large scale. Developed in the early 1990s, Python has become one of the fastest-growing programming languages because of its scalability, adaptability, and ease of learning.